Thanksgiving Value Plays

Tyrone Tracy Jr. ($5,800) at Dallas Cowboys

During a grim time in New York football history, Tyrone Tracy Jr. has been a dim beacon of light for a prosperous future. The rookie from Purdue currently has the most rushing yards out of any first-year back, having triple the production of the third spot on that list. Even with a disastrous offensive line and substandard passing attack, Tracy Jr. has shown plenty of flashes. He’s averaging over five yards a carry and is a competent receiver out of the backfield.

Ball security has slowed his ascent—notably, he coughed up the rock in overtime against Carolina to effectively lose that game. He had another pivotal fumble near the goalline in the recent loss against Tampa Bay and was subsequently benched for a few series afterward. This is a concern for many rushers early in their careers—it’s not a long-term concern quite yet.

This club’s best chance at finding the endzone is feeding Tracy Jr. and trying to wear teams out on the ground. Even with his recent stumbles, he’s still a dynamite runner who makes spectacular plays out of nothing. Dallas has a decent front seven but is vulnerable to allowing chunk gains. I love Tracy Jr.’s price and think he can be a steal for your lineup.

Keenan Allen ($5,100) at Detroit Lions

At his best, Keenan Allen is still a route-running messiah who can create separation in a flash. Much has been made of the disappointing Chicago aerial attack, but it looks like they finally figured something out last week. Allen netted an absurd 15 targets, corralling nine for 86 yards and a score. It was the first time the veteran wideout crossed the 50-yard mark on the season and only the second contest where he found the endzone. 

The 32-year-old should benefit from a rookie signal caller. Allen does most of his work near the sticks, has a reliable pair of hands, and can do damage after the catch. For some reason, the chemistry with Caleb Williams has been off, but after getting such attention Sunday, it’s safe to assume that the partnership is trending upwards. 

Detroit’s weakest point is its secondary, which has played far better than the sum of its parts so far this campaign. Allen will be the focal point of the gameplan for Chicago in a divisional game it’s desperate to win.
